Zachary Piper Solutions is seeking a CyberArk Engineer to support a high-impact federal initiative focused on securing privileged access across complex, mission-critical environments. This position offers the opportunity to work with a mature PAM program, lead upgrades/migrations, and directly influence enterprise-wide security posture. The role is remote with a competitive salary of $100,000–$120,000.


This is a remote position, that requires a green card or U.S. citizenship, along with the ability to travel to Alexandria, VA or Rockville, MD once a month.

Responsibilities for the CyberArk Engineer:

  • Install, configure, upgrade, and maintain CyberArk components including PSM, PSMP, PVWA, CPM, SCIM, and Digital Vault
  • Lead full-scale CyberArk upgrades and migration events, ensuring minimal downtime and accurate cutover
  • Configure CyberArk for RDP and SSH session workflows
  • Implement and troubleshoot CyberArk Auto-Discovery for domain-joined servers and endpoints
  • Analyze CyberArk logs, Splunk logs, and basic network/firewall logs to isolate and resolve issues
  • Support certificate management functions across CyberArk components
  • Collaborate with security, network, and platform teams to ensure PAM policies and configurations align with enterprise standards
  • Provide technical documentation and contribute to process improvements within the PAM program

Qualifications for the CyberArk Engineer:

  • Bachelor’s degree in IT, Cybersecurity, Computer Science, or related field
  • 5+ years of hands-on CyberArk engineering experience
  • Proven experience installing, upgrading, and troubleshooting:
    • PSM, PSMP, PVWA, CPM, SCIM, Vault
  • Hands-on expertise with:
    • CyberArk migrations
    • Auto-Discovery configuration
    • RDP/SSH session setup
    • Privileged session and account workflows
  • Ability to read and interpret CyberArk, Splunk, and network/firewall logs to isolate root-cause issues
  • Working knowledge of firewall rules, network flows, and segmentation as they relate to PAM
  • Experience with enterprise certificate management
  • Strong communication skills and ability to work with both technical and non-technical teams
